Output 42fd497958feee2c8d19f618bc3fe268e700f7856a3a9b38fd5e13575299f044:1

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d17389c2e01b06e60f8af75e0bab55f3655d42 OP_EQUAL
address
3JMfpPZWWta4mU7Zh4nFiUtDXVU89MAAa9
transaction
42fd497958feee2c8d19f618bc3fe268e700f7856a3a9b38fd5e13575299f044
confirmations
308094
spent
true